CONCEVOIR DES INTERFACES DE PROGRAMMATION
Interfaces web, Intranet, Extranet, USSD etc., Eyolvi conçoit pour vous des interfaces de programmation d'applications qui répondent aux exigences de vos objectifs avec une expérience utilisateur ergonomique, la plus satisfaisante et productive possible.
QU'EST-CE QU'UNE API ?
Une interface de programmation est une façade clairement délimitée par laquelle un logiciel offre des services à d'autres logiciels. L'objectif est de fournir une porte d'accès à une fonctionnalité en cachant les détails de la mise en œuvre. Le plus souvent une interface de programmation est mise en œuvre par une bibliothèque logicielle qui fournit une solution à un problème informatique en faisant abstraction de son fonctionnement.
La description de l'interface de programmation spécifie comment des clients peuvent interagir avec le logiciel en mettant l'accent sur les fonctionnalités offertes par ce dernier. Une interface de programmation peut être utilisée dans plusieurs programmes et sert alors de jeu de construction, offrant des pièces de fonctionnalités qui peuvent être intégrées dans des applications. Un exemple de leur mise en pratique peut être un programme USSD tel que les services par SMS offerts par les opérateurs de téléphonie.
DANS QUELS CAS AURIEZ-VOUS BESOIN D'UNE API ?
Comme nous l'avons vu plus tôt, les APIs sont utiles dans de nombreux cas:
- Fournir un accès à votre application sans la compromettre
- Créer une application USSD
- Créer une interface graphique à votre centre de données (base de données, fichiers excels, etc.)
Vous avez un projet d'application USSD que vous voudriez soumettre à un opératuer de téléphonie ? Vous avez une application et vous voudriez mettre quelques-unes de ses fonctionnalités à disposition d'une communauté de programmeurs ? Vous avez une base de données ou un fichier excel volumineux sur lesquels vous devez faire des opérations récurrentes et vous voulez automatiser ces aopérations ? N'hésitez pas à nous contacter !